Setting the Stage for CreativityTo turn scrapbooking into a memorable date night, the environment needs to feel special. Transforming a dining table or a clean living room floor into a creative studio sets the right mood. Spreading out a soft blanket, lighting a few candles, and playing a curated playlist of favorite songs instantly elevates the atmosphere. Good lighting is essential for sorting small details, but the overall vibe should remain relaxed and inviting.A successful crafting date also relies on a delightful spread of snacks and drinks. Opt for finger foods that are not overly greasy to protect the photos and paper from stains. Charcuterie boards, grapes, chocolates, and wine or sparkling mocktails are perfect accompaniments. Having these treats nearby encourages a slow, leisurely pace, allowing the evening to unfold naturally without any rush.
Gathering the Perfect SuppliesPreparation is key to keeping the momentum going during the date. Before the evening begins, select and print a variety of photos from different milestones in the relationship. Include pictures from early dates, major trips, silly everyday moments, and celebrations. Having a physical stack of memories to flip through immediately sparks conversation and nostalgia.In addition to photos, gather a well-curated selection of crafting supplies. A blank scrapbook album with thick pages forms the foundation. Add colorful cardstock, patterned patterned papers, double-sided tape, photo corners, and metallic markers. To make the pages truly unique, collect mementos from past adventures, such as concert tickets, plane stubs, restaurant menus, or pressed flowers. These tactile elements add depth and texture to the story.
Collaborating on the LayoutsThe true joy of a scrapbooking date night lies in the collaborative process of designing each page. Instead of working on separate projects, couples should build the album together. This can be approached by assigning different roles, like one person cutting and placing elements while the other writes captions. Alternatively, partners can take turns designing alternating pages, surprising each other with their creative choices.Deciding on a theme for each page helps guide the design process. One spread might focus on the very first vacation taken together, using a color scheme inspired by the destination. Another page could be dedicated entirely to funny candid moments or a timeline of relationship milestones. Discussing how to arrange the photos and which stories to highlight fosters a wonderful sense of partnership and shared vision.
Preserving Your Unique StoryWhile the visual elements make a scrapbook beautiful, the handwritten notes and captions give it a soul. Taking time to write down specific details, dates, locations, and inside jokes ensures that the context of each memory is preserved forever. Partners can write love notes to each other directly on the pages or jot down their favorite memories from the day the photo was taken.
